دلیل دریافت خطای کد 500 چیست؟

توجه! این آموزش مربوط به سرویس هاستینگ لینوکس است.

ارور یا خطای کد 500 معمولا به دلیل دستورات غلط یا ناقص در فایل htaccess. است. دیگر مواردی که معمولا اتفاق میافتد، یا دستورات اشتباه تایپی داشته، یا به درستی به ابتدای خط بعدی اضافه نشده اند(استفاده از ویرایشگرهای ویندوزی مثل نت پد که با لینوکس سازگار نیستند) و یا نسخه وب سرور پیکربندی شده از یک یا چند دستور موجود در فایل پشتیبانی نمی کند.

روش خطایابی:

ابتدا فایل htaccess را تغییر نام دهید؛ اگر خطا برطرف شد، فایل htaccess را با ویرایشگر مناسب مثل ++NotePad که رایگان است ویرایش کنید و در جای خود مجددا ذخیره کنید.

برای ویرایش و یافتن خط دستور مشکل ساز، خط به خط دستورات را کامنت کنید.(با افزودن # به اول خط دستور) و فایل را ذخیره کنید تا به خط دستور مشکل ساز برسید.

برای مشاهده پلن های هاست به صفحه خرید هاست وب رمز مراجعه نمایید.

آیا این پاسخ به شما کمک کرد؟

رتبه: 4.9 از 352 رأی
 پرینت این مقاله

مطالب مرتبط:

آپلود اطلاعات سایت انجام شده ولی همچنان صفحه پیش فرض وب رمز نمایش داده می شود

به صورت پیش فرض یک فایل ایندکس(index.shtml) در پوشه پابلیک هاست شما موجود است که مربوط به نمایش...

بلوک شدن آی پی توسط سرور

سرورهای لینوکس وب رمز به لایه های چنگانه امنیتی مجهز است و به دلایل مختلفی از جمله اشتباه وارد...

ارسال ایمیل انبوه و تغییر پرمیشن فولدر و عدم کارکرد صحیح سایت

سایت بدلیل ارسال ایمیل انبوه توسط سرور بلاک شده است. ارسال ایمیل انبوه به هر دلیل بر روی سرویس...

خطای couldn't connect to database

برای بررسی دلیل ایجاد خطای عدم اتصال به دیتابیس، لازم است ابتدا دیتابیس و یوزرهای آن را چک کنید....

تغییر پرمیشن فایل و فولدرها

در لینوکس، پرمیشن فایلها بطور معمول می بایست بر روی 644 و فولدرها بر روی 755 تنظیم باشد تا برنامه...